Fluoresceins: A family of spiro(isobenzofuran-1(3H),9'-(9H)xanthen)-3-one derivatives. These are used as dyes, as indicators for various metals, and as fluorescent labels in immunoassays.

Fistula: Abnormal communication most commonly seen between two internal organs, or between an internal organ and the surface of the body.
